- Abstract
Strategic decisions are often made in highly uncertain conditions by a coalition of actors which are driven by their self or subunit interests, thus have conflicting strategic agendas. In these conditions, the use of heuristic decision making that exerts practical rationality is required to arrive at high quality strategic decisions. This research introduces 'eristic argumentation' as a major threat to the effective using of heuristics in strategic decision making. Eristic argumentation abuses reasoning to defeat the counter party at all costs. This study contributes to the micro-foundations of strategy literature by discussing the bases of eristic argumentation, its markers and its consequences for organizations.
